ROAD TRAFFIC REGULATION ACT 1984 - SECTION 14(1)(a)
THE A38 TRUNK ROAD (RIPLEY,DERBYSHIRE)
(TEMPORARY PROHIBITION OF TRAFFIC) ORDER 2025
N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that National Highways Limited (Company No. 9346363) has made an order on the A38 Trunk Road, at Ripley, in the County of Derbyshire, to enable drainage works to be carried out.
The effect of the Order will be to close –
(1) the slip road leading from the southbound carriageway of the A38 to the roundabout junction with the A610 and the B6441, at Ripley; and
(2) the layby adjacent to the southbound carriageway of the A38 approximately 550 metres northeast of its junction with the slip road described in (1) above.
The work is expected to be carried out between 20:00 hours on Friday 1 August 2025 and 06:00 hours on Monday 4 August 2025. The Order will come into force on 25 July 2025.
Vehicles being used for police, fire and rescue authority or ambulance purposes and vehicles being used in connection with the works will be exempt from the closures.
A diversion route via the A38 to Little Eaton Roundabout will be signed
